CSS disparaît : problèmes courants à éviter dans la conception de sites Web

PHPz
Libérer: 2023-04-24 10:03:51
original
624 Les gens l'ont consulté

Dans la conception de sites Web d’aujourd’hui, l’utilisation de feuilles de style CSS est essentielle. Cela peut nous aider à contrôler la mise en page, les polices, les couleurs et d'autres éléments de conception de la page Web, rendant ainsi l'apparence du site Web et l'expérience utilisateur plus unifiées. Cependant, lors du processus de conception de sites Web, la disparition des CSS est un problème très courant. Si les feuilles de style CSS ne peuvent pas être chargées correctement, la mise en page et l’apparence du site Web seront affectées et donneront une mauvaise expérience aux utilisateurs. Dans cet article, nous explorerons les raisons pour lesquelles CSS disparaît et comment éviter ce problème.

1. En raison de problèmes de connexion réseau

La première raison pouvant entraîner la disparition du CSS est les problèmes de connexion réseau. À l’ère actuelle de l’Internet haut débit, la plupart des utilisateurs ont accès à des vitesses de réseau plus rapides que jamais. Cependant, il arrive parfois que le serveur ne réponde pas rapidement ou que la connexion réseau de l'utilisateur soit instable, ce qui empêche le chargement correct de la page Web. Dans ce cas, la feuille de style CSS peut ne pas se charger, ce qui entraînera une dégradation de l'apparence du site.

Pour éviter ce problème, nous vous recommandons d'utiliser un Content Delivery Network (CDN) ou d'autres technologies pour accélérer le chargement des feuilles de style CSS. De plus, vous pouvez utiliser des préprocesseurs CSS tels que Sass ou Less pour réduire la taille du fichier CSS et le temps de chargement.

2. Parce que le chemin du fichier est erroné

Une autre raison qui peut provoquer la disparition du CSS est que le chemin du fichier est erroné. Si le chemin d'accès au fichier CSS est mal défini, le navigateur ne pourra pas trouver correctement le fichier CSS et ne pourra pas charger la feuille de style. Il s'agit généralement d'un problème provoqué par des paramètres de chemin relatif ou absolu incorrects.

Pour éviter ce problème, nous vous recommandons d'utiliser des chemins relatifs lors de la définition des chemins de fichiers CSS et de toujours utiliser des barres obliques au lieu de barres obliques inverses. De plus, vous pouvez utiliser des outils professionnels de définition de chemin de fichier pour vous assurer que le chemin est correctement défini.

3. À cause d'erreurs de code

La troisième raison qui peut provoquer la disparition du CSS est les erreurs de code. Si le code CSS comporte des erreurs de syntaxe ou d’autres problèmes, tels que des accolades manquantes, des points-virgules ou d’autres erreurs courantes, le fichier CSS ne sera pas analysé correctement. Cela empêche les styles du site de se charger correctement et peut provoquer un crash du site.

Pour éviter ce problème, nous vous recommandons d'utiliser des outils d'édition de code pour écrire du code CSS et de prêter attention aux meilleures pratiques d'écriture. Si vous rencontrez des erreurs de syntaxe, vous pouvez utiliser un validateur CSS pour vérifier l'exactitude de votre code CSS.

4. En raison de problèmes de mise en cache

La dernière raison pouvant entraîner la disparition du CSS est celle des problèmes de mise en cache. Les navigateurs mettent en cache les fichiers CSS localement afin qu'ils se chargent plus rapidement lors des visites ultérieures sur le même site Web. Cependant, si un site Web met à jour ses feuilles de style CSS et que le navigateur utilise toujours une ancienne version des fichiers mis en cache, le site Web peut avoir une apparence incorrecte.

Pour résoudre ce problème, nous pouvons utiliser des techniques de contrôle du cache, telles que la définition d'un cycle de vie du cache approprié ou l'utilisation du contrôle de version. De plus, vous pouvez forcer le navigateur à télécharger une nouvelle version de la feuille de style en modifiant le nom du fichier CSS.

Résumé :

Dans cet article, nous avons discuté d'un problème courant dans la conception de sites Web, à savoir la disparition du CSS. Pour éviter ce problème, nous vous recommandons d'utiliser CDN ou d'autres technologies pour accélérer le chargement des feuilles de style CSS, d'utiliser des chemins relatifs pour définir les chemins des fichiers CSS, d'utiliser des outils d'édition de code pour écrire du code CSS et de prêter attention aux meilleures pratiques d'écriture et d'utiliser le cache. technologie de contrôle pour contrôler la mise en cache des fichiers CSS. En suivant ces bonnes pratiques, nous pouvons garantir que la conception de notre site Web est plus stable et fiable, et offre une meilleure expérience utilisateur.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al